What particulate, vapors & gases do Xcaper masks filter?
The Xcaper Smoke Mask will capture smoke, dust, airborne fiber and other particulate matter as miniscule as 3/10ths of a micron (a strand of hair is about 10 microns). It will also filters water-soluble gases known as anhydrites. Additionally, the Xcaper smoke mask filters other dangerous gases commonly found in the air near a fire such as carbon monoxide, acrolein, hydrogen cyanide, nitrogen dioxide and nitrogen monoxide. The Xcaper smoke mask has also been field tested against petrochemical fumes and it worked well.
